“Do not judge this place based on solely on what angry orchard releases commercially. This is where they work on their upscale and experimental ciders. As such you will find something for every palette here: sweet, dry, barrel aged, rose,… you name it, they’ve tried it.
I am especially fond of their wooden sleeper series and look forward to the release events for each of the annual verities (wassail especially).
It’s difficult to recommend food as the offerings are always changing, but you can count on getting something to eat weather from their kitchen or a visiting food truck or a local pop-up.
They often have fun events and live music. Make sure to check their website before visiting to see if there is an event going that you’d like to participate in. I’ve see new release events, cider float events, ugly sweater party’s, apple blossom festivals, Kentucky derby viewing events, themed trivia events, board game nights, and so much more.“
